Job summary

This post offers an excellent on-the-job training opportunity in our customer focused, proactive Supplies and Procurement Department which is responsible for purchasing a comprehensive range of goods and services and delivering an enhanced materials management services to wards and theatres.

Main duties of the job

This role entails a range of supply chain duties that encompasses, raising orders, stock receipting, stock delivery, stock management and stock replenishment. The post involves the use of computerised ordering systems and Microsoft Office Applications e.g. Word, Excel, Access and Outlook.

Candidates should have good interpersonal and customer service skills, a good standard of written and verbal English, good organisational skills and be able to work as an effective team member together with a flexible and self-motivated approach to work.

About us

University Hospitals of North Midlands NHS Trust is one of the largest and most modern in the country. We serve around three million people and were highly regarded for our facilities, teaching and research. The Trust has around 1,450 inpatient beds across two sites in Stoke-on-Trent and Stafford. Our 11,000 strong workforce provide emergency treatment, planned operations and medical care from Royal Stoke University Hospital and County Hospital in Stafford.

We are the specialist centre for major trauma for the North Midlands and North Wales.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
